Output ef0cf1a02868d4aeef4b4e7d666fa22e3c156c986818de3bff47da7ef89285cc:52

value
91885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f57553f6ec27845c4d9e804d0aeee8f038c427e OP_EQUAL
address
3EkwAyiUpfddSw8G1ZrEX26TW9wduaaNaD
transaction
ef0cf1a02868d4aeef4b4e7d666fa22e3c156c986818de3bff47da7ef89285cc
confirmations
271545
spent
true